The video discusses the Fed Chair's speech at the Kansas City Fed Symposium, focusing on the Fed's commitment to raising interest rates to control inflation, even at the risk of recession. The speech's impact on market conditions and traders' reactions are also covered, highlighting the Fed's firm stance on monetary policy.
